Qualifications – Northern Ontario Healthcare Facility

  • Registered Nurse registered and in good standing with the College of Nurses of Ontario (CNO) required
  • Minimum 2–3 years of recent Emergency Department experience preferred
  • CTAS (Canadian Triage and Acuity Scale) certification required
  • ACLS certification required
  • TNCC (Trauma Nursing Core Course) certification required
  • PALS (Pediatric Advanced Life Support) certification required
  • Experience with Expanse and PCC electronic health record systems required
  • Start Date: ASAP
  • End Date: 3 months + possibility of extension
  • Must be willing to travel between multiple sites if required
  • Accommodations: Provided
  • Travel: Covered
  • Overtime: Applicable (High paying with OT)

Responsibilities:

Registered Nurses are required to adhere to the scope of practice as defined by the College of Nurses of Ontario. Responsibilities may include but are not limited to:

  • Provide emergency nursing care including triage, assessment, and treatment of acute and trauma patients
  • Administer medications, IV therapies, and emergency interventions
  • Monitor patient conditions and respond to critical changes
  • Collaborate with physicians and interdisciplinary teams to ensure optimal patient outcomes
  • Float between sites as required to support operational needs
  • Maintain accurate and timely electronic documentation using Expanse and PCC systems
  • Ensure compliance with infection control and patient safety protocols
